As follows from Chart 1, many data rates allows to use multiple
line coding modes. Rule: apply a coding mode with less positions
(ТСРАМ8, ТСРАМ4) on a line exposed to high level of noise;
apply a coding mode with more positions (ТСРАМ32, ТСРАМ16)
if bandwidth is limited.
In the local configuration mode (CFG=LOCAL) all four variations of the line
coding are applicable. In the Preactivation mode (CFG=PREACT), only two
codings can be used: TCPAM16 in the 192 to 3840 kbps range and TCPAM32
in the 768 to 5696 kbps range.
If the data rate is not within the permitted range for an entered line coding
mode, the following message appears:
invalid line code for this
rate
.
3.3.4 Link statistics
Use the
dsl
command with the
stat
option to view link statistics:
: dsl stat
DSL: CFG=LOCAL Rate=512 Code=TCPAM8 SLAVE Annex=A - ONLINE
TX=1341 RX=1231 ERR=1 LOSW=12 CRC6=11 RETRAIN=2 of 5
Loop Loss: 0.0 dB Noise Margin: +22.0 dB
Total online time: 0 days 00:42:19
Total offline time: 0 days 00:18:02
Connect duration: 0 days 00:15:53
:
Legend:
ONLINE
– the DSL link is activated;
OFFLINE
– the DSL link is not activated;
TX
– the number of transmitted packets;
RX
– the number of received packets;
ERR
– the number of received packets with errors;
LOSW
– the number of frame synchronization loss events;
CRC6
– the number of CRC6 checksum errors;
